Royal London Ireland, a leading provider of life insurance and pensions, has appointed Brendan Cummins as Senior Broker Consultant, strengthening its advisory capacity in the south-east of the country.
Mr Cummins, whose career in financial services spans more than 25 years, brings extensive experience across banking, life insurance, pensions, and broker consultancy. In his new role, he will provide guidance to financial brokers across Tipperary, Kilkenny, and Waterford, focusing on Royal London Ireland’s life and pensions solutions.

Beyond his professional credentials, Mr Cummins is widely recognised for his contributions to Irish sport. A former goalkeeper for Tipperary’s senior hurling team, he is a two-time All-Ireland champion, five-time Munster winner, and five-time All-Star recipient. He currently manages the Tipperary under-20 hurling team, which secured the 2025 All-Ireland title earlier this year.
